How to Use These Morning Prayer Messages

Start by thinking about who you are sending this to and what they need right now. A tired parent needs a different message than a friend starting a new job.

Pick a message that matches the moment, then personalize it with their name or a detail only you would know. These messages work anywhere.

Text them first thing in the morning, write them inside a card, post them for a group chat, or simply say them out loud over breakfast.

Tips for Writing Your Own Morning Prayer Message

  • Be specific about what someone actually needs, not just general good wishes. A message that mentions their exact situation, like a stressful week or a hard diagnosis, feels far more sincere than a generic blessing.
  • Match the tone to the relationship. A message to a close friend can sound casual and warm, while a message to a grieving coworker should stay softer and simpler.
  • Keep the language open, even while naming God or the Lord directly. Pairing that language with words like hope, peace, and strength lets the sentiment come through without leaning on any one denomination.
  • Send it early. A message that arrives before someone’s day starts, rather than hours in, has more of a chance to actually shape their morning.
  • Do not overthink it. A short, honest message sent consistently means more than one perfect message sent once.

Frequently Asked Questions

What are good morning prayer messages?

Good morning prayer messages are short, sincere notes sent early in the day to ask God’s blessing over someone or offer them comfort, hope, and encouragement. They can be simple, like a single line wishing someone peace, or longer, more reflective messages for someone going through a hard time.

How do you write a morning prayer message?

Start by thinking about the person and what they need right now, then keep the language warm and simple, naming God or the Lord where it feels natural. Mention something specific if you can, like a project they are nervous about or a hard week they just had, and close with a genuine wish for their day.

How long should a morning prayer message be?

There is no set length. A single sentence works fine for a quick text, while a longer, more heartfelt message suits a card or a moment that calls for something deeper. Match the length to the relationship and the occasion.

What do you say in a morning prayer message?

Focus on hope, peace, strength, and gratitude, and feel free to include God or the Lord directly. Keeping the language general rather than tied to one specific tradition makes these messages easy to send to almost anyone.

Can you send a morning prayer message to someone of any faith?


Yes. Using open language, God and the Lord alongside words like peace, strength, and hope rather than specific denominational terms, makes these messages appropriate for a wide range of beliefs.
